About the Recipe
Aloo ki kachori is a well-known North Indian street food recipe that is especially well-liked in Uttar Pradesh and Agra. It is made of boiling potatoes, herbs, and is stuffed inside a flat rolled wheat flour dough. They go well with green chutney or tomato ketchup.
